This is an automated email from the ASF dual-hosted git repository.
markusthoemmes p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/openwhisk.git
The following commit(s) were added to refs/heads/master by this push:
new 01b4963 Some small compilation fixes for 2.13 migration. (#4836)
01b4963 is described below
commit 01b4963c233835c06bac29b3831e75553f3e2cae
Author: Markus Thömmes <[email protected]>
AuthorDate: Tue Feb 25 11:02:43 2020 +0100
Some small compilation fixes for 2.13 migration. (#4836)
---
.../scala/org/apache/openwhisk/core/connector/Message.scala | 2 +-
.../core/database/cosmosdb/CosmosDBArtifactStore.scala | 2 +-
.../openwhisk/core/database/cosmosdb/CosmosDBSupport.scala | 11 ++++++++++-
.../scala/org/apache/openwhisk/core/mesos/MesosTask.scala | 2 +-
.../core/database/cosmosdb/CosmosDBArtifactStoreTests.scala | 2 +-
5 files changed, 14 insertions(+), 5 deletions(-)
diff --git
a/common/scala/src/main/scala/org/apache/openwhisk/core/connector/Message.scala
b/common/scala/src/main/scala/org/apache/openwhisk/core/connector/Message.scala
index fdd024d..4326109 100644
---
a/common/scala/src/main/scala/org/apache/openwhisk/core/connector/Message.scala
+++
b/common/scala/src/main/scala/org/apache/openwhisk/core/connector/Message.scala
@@ -357,7 +357,7 @@ object Activation extends DefaultJsonProtocol {
statusCode match {
case Some(value) =>
- Try { value.convertTo[BigInt].intValue() } match {
+ Try { value.convertTo[BigInt].intValue } match {
case Failure(_) => Some(BadRequest.intValue)
case Success(code) => Some(code)
}
diff --git
a/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Store.scala
b/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Store.scala
index 0ad9ab5..038c86a 100644
---
a/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Store.scala
+++
b/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Store.scala
@@ -365,7 +365,7 @@ class CosmosDBArtifactStore[DocumentAbstraction <:
DocumentSerializer](protected
val g = f.andThen {
case Success(queryResult) =>
if (queryMetrics.nonEmpty) {
- val combinedMetrics = QueryMetrics.ZERO.add(queryMetrics: _*)
+ val combinedMetrics = QueryMetrics.ZERO.add(queryMetrics.toSeq: _*)
logging.debug(
this,
s"[QueryMetricsEnabled] Collection [$collName] - Query
[${querySpec.getQueryText}].\nQueryMetrics\n[$combinedMetrics]")
diff --git
a/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BSupport.scala
b/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BSupport.scala
index 5532bf1..bcec58d 100644
---
a/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BSupport.scala
+++
b/common/scala/src/main/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BSupport.scala
@@ -17,7 +17,16 @@
package org.apache.openwhisk.core.database.cosmosdb
-import com.microsoft.azure.cosmosdb._
+import com.microsoft.azure.cosmosdb.{
+ Database,
+ DocumentCollection,
+ FeedResponse,
+ RequestOptions,
+ Resource,
+ SqlParameter,
+ SqlParameterCollection,
+ SqlQuerySpec
+}
import com.microsoft.azure.cosmosdb.rx.AsyncDocumentClient
import org.apache.openwhisk.common.Logging
diff --git
a/common/scala/src/main/scala/org/apache/openwhisk/core/mesos/MesosTask.scala
b/common/scala/src/main/scala/org/apache/openwhisk/core/mesos/MesosTask.scala
index a6abec4..fc42b24 100644
---
a/common/scala/src/main/scala/org/apache/openwhisk/core/mesos/MesosTask.scala
+++
b/common/scala/src/main/scala/org/apache/openwhisk/core/mesos/MesosTask.scala
@@ -97,7 +97,7 @@ object MesosTask {
case "host" => Host
case _ => User(network)
}
- val dnsOrEmpty = if (dnsServers.nonEmpty) Map("dns" -> dnsServers.toSet)
else Map.empty
+ val dnsOrEmpty = if (dnsServers.nonEmpty) Map("dns" -> dnsServers.toSet)
else Map.empty[String, Set[String]]
//transform our config to mesos-actor config:
val healthCheckConfig = mesosConfig.healthCheck.map(
diff --git
a/tests/src/test/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StoreTests.scala
b/tests/src/test/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StoreTests.scala
index 566d2ba..a5c6fc9 100644
---
a/tests/src/test/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StoreTests.scala
+++
b/tests/src/test/scala/org/apache/openwhisk/core/database/cosmosdb/CosmosDBArtifactStoreTests.scala
@@ -186,7 +186,7 @@ class CosmosDBArtifactStoreTests extends FlatSpec with
CosmosDBStoreBehaviorBase
//would increment a counter
if (TransactionId.metricsKamonTags) {
RetryMetricsCollector.getCounter(CosmosDBAction.Create) match {
- case Some(x: LongAdder) => x.snapshot(false).intValue()
+ case Some(x: LongAdder) => x.snapshot(false).intValue
case _ => 0
}
} else {